Materials and Manufacturing Processes

The cost of golf balls is heavily influenced by the quality and complexity of the materials used, as well as the intricate manufacturing processes involved. Golf balls are not merely simple spheres; they are engineered with precision to meet specific performance standards, which demands advanced materials and meticulous production techniques.

Golf balls typically consist of multiple layers, each made from specialized materials designed to optimize distance, control, and durability:

  • Core: Usually made of synthetic rubber or similar polymers, the core is the energy source of the ball. High-performance cores are designed to maximize energy transfer and ball speed.
  • Mantle Layers: These intermediate layers, often made from ionomers or other resin blends, help control spin and improve the ball’s responsiveness.
  • Cover: The outermost layer is commonly made of urethane or Surlyn. Urethane covers offer superior feel and spin control but are more expensive to produce, while Surlyn covers are more durable but less costly.

The manufacturing process involves multiple stages such as molding, curing, and finishing. Each stage requires precise control to ensure consistent quality, which contributes to the overall expense. For example, urethane covers must be carefully molded and then coated with protective finishes to maintain durability and playability.

Research and Development Investment

Golf ball manufacturers invest heavily in research and development (R&D) to innovate and improve ball performance. This ongoing investment is a significant factor in the high retail price of golf balls. Companies conduct extensive testing using advanced technologies including high-speed cameras, wind tunnels, and computer simulations to optimize aerodynamics, compression, and spin characteristics.

R&D efforts focus on:

  • Developing new materials that enhance distance without sacrificing control.
  • Refining dimple patterns to reduce drag and improve flight stability.
  • Creating multi-layer constructions that balance power and feel.
  • Enhancing durability to extend the lifespan of each ball.

These innovations require substantial financial resources and expert personnel, including material scientists, engineers, and professional players who provide feedback during product testing.

Quality Control and Testing

Ensuring that every golf ball meets strict performance and durability standards requires rigorous quality control and testing procedures. Manufacturers implement automated inspection systems and manual checks to detect defects in shape, weight, compression, and cover integrity.

Key quality control measures include:

  • Dimensional accuracy testing to ensure uniform size and weight.
  • Compression testing to maintain consistent performance characteristics.
  • Surface inspection to prevent imperfections that could affect flight.
  • Durability testing including impact resistance and abrasion tests.

These processes increase production costs but are essential for maintaining the high standards expected by golfers at all levels.

Durability and Performance Expectations

Golfers expect balls to perform consistently over multiple rounds, which necessitates more robust materials and manufacturing standards. The cost of ensuring that balls maintain their aerodynamic integrity, spin characteristics, and feel over time adds to production expenses.

Environmental and Regulatory Compliance

Manufacturers must adhere to environmental regulations regarding chemical use and waste disposal, as well as conform to standards set by governing bodies like the USGA and R&A. Compliance entails investment in cleaner processes and certification testing, which indirectly affects the final price.

Why Premium Golf Balls Command a Higher Price Point

Premium golf balls are engineered to meet the demands of skilled players seeking enhanced control, spin, and feel. These balls typically differ from standard or value options in several ways:

  • Multi-layer Construction: Premium balls often have three or more layers, each optimized for specific performance traits. This complexity increases production cost but offers better feel and shot shaping ability.
  • Soft Urethane Covers: The use of urethane instead of ionomer provides superior spin control and a softer feel, but this material is more expensive and requires more careful manufacturing.
  • Refined Dimple Patterns: The design and precision of dimples affect lift, drag, and stability. Premium balls use advanced aerodynamic patterns developed through extensive research.
  • Consistent Compression and Weight: These balls are manufactured with tighter tolerances to ensure consistent behavior, especially important for professionals and low-handicap golfers.
